In today’s episode, I have a conversation with Teacher Julie about "emails". This episode will give you the vocabulary and expressions you need to speak fluently in English about this topic.

NEW WORDS & EXPRESSIONS IN THIS EPISODE
======================================

  1. Spam email
  2. Templates
  3. Acting up (Hotmail started acting up)
  4. A blessing and a curse
  5. Privacy policy
  6. The rest is history
  7. Email thread
  8. Sentimental
  9. Doodling
  10. Calligraphy
  11. Heartfelt
  12. Leaving for good
  13. Sensitive information (Sensitive subject/topic)
  14. Establishment
  15. Fraudulent purchase
  16. We were going back and forth
  17. Relive
  18. Hard conversation
  19. Lose your train of thought
  20. A period of rockiness / rocky period
  21. Put things out there
  22. Blow off steam
  23. Be calculated
  24. Hit a nerve
  25. Misconstrue
  26. The tone of your email
